bpa wrote: > I agree - only ever use channel 1, 6 or 11. Any of the other channels > will have overlaps. If neighbours have configured router with auto > channel changing - check analyser each day and see if neighbour channel > selection changes. Many router always start at low channels so > selecting channel 11 can have fewest users. > > Is there a power saving option on the AP ? Is it active ? Can you > disable it ?
